Overview
Procure the development of a minimum viable product (MVP) for a Place-Based Directory of Services from Jan-Mar19 and, thereafter, 2 years of software as a service from Apr19-Mar21. The work will be phased with separate contracts for each phase to provide protection, control and insight to the organisation.
